Thrace, Cherronesos. Ca. 386-338 B.C. AR hemidrachm (15.9 mm, 2.32 g). Forepart of lion right, head turned back / Quadripartite incuse square with alternate quadrants deeper. In one quadrant: dot and monogram, bee in opposite quadrant. Cf. SNG.Cop.831-833. VF, well-struck, two very small edge splits, light gray+green patina as old cleaning ages gracefully.
